RIVIERA BEACH, Fla. (CBS12) — Riviera Beach police are seeking first-degree murder charges for a 27-year-old in the ICU after he allegedly shot and killed his girlfriend before turning the gun on himself.
At 6:25 p.m. on Wednesday, officers with the Riviera Beach Police Department (RBPD) were called to the Thousand Oaks gated community for reports of seven shots fired.
Witnesses told the responding officer that one person was shot and that the shooter had also shot himself.
Officers later detained the suspected shooter, 27-year-old Roberto Ernest Torres, and rushed him and the victim, 29-year-old Faith Nelson, to Saint Mary’s Medical Center’s Trauma Center. Around two hours later, Nelson succumbed to her injuries and died in the hospital…
